Nscale, a UK-based cloud computing company specializing in GPU rental services, has appointed three former executives from Meta to its board of directors. This strategic move coincides with the completion of a Series C funding round that raised $2 billion, valuing the company at $14.6 billion.
New Board Members
The newly appointed board members include Sir Nick Clegg, former deputy prime minister and Meta’s ex-president of global affairs; Sheryl Sandberg, who served as Meta’s chief operating officer from 2008 to 2022; and Susan Decker, former president of Yahoo. Nscale confirmed these appointments alongside the funding announcement.
Expertise and Background
Sir Nick Clegg brings significant experience at the intersection of technology and policy, having previously defended Meta’s positions on various regulatory matters. His recent comments on AI copyright issues suggest a focus on minimizing regulatory burdens for tech companies. Clegg is also a general partner at Hiro Capital, which invests in emerging technologies.
Sheryl Sandberg, who remained on Meta’s board until 2024, has been involved in investment ventures following her departure. Her tenure at Meta included significant involvement in the company’s strategic decisions during a tumultuous period marked by privacy controversies.
Susan Decker, known for her leadership at Yahoo and her current board roles at several major companies, is expected to contribute financial and governance expertise to Nscale.
Funding and Future Plans
The Series C funding round was led by Aker ASA and 8090 Industries, with participation from major players like Dell, Lenovo, and Nvidia. This influx of capital will support Nscale’s ongoing projects, including a joint venture with Aker aimed at constructing a 230 MW datacenter to provide 100,000 Nvidia GPUs for OpenAI by the end of 2026.
Nscale’s strategic moves, including the board appointments and funding, position the company to enhance its capabilities in the competitive cloud computing market, particularly in AI and GPU services.
